I'll be using this thread to predict 40-man roster adds next winter. I've gotten the adds right 2 years straight, hoping to make it 3. Link to last year's thread. I'll check in every month or so to see where things stand.

Here's where I see things now before the minor league season starts. Tony's prospect ranking in parentheses:

Locks:

1. Coby Mayo (3)

2. Chayce McDermott (9)

3. Connor Norby (11)

4. Cade Povich (13)

Unlikely:

5. Brandon Young (30)

6. Jean Pinto (33)

7. Keagan Gillies (34)

8. Hudson Haskin (36)

9. Justin Armbreuster (46)

10. John Rhodes (48)

Other eligible names to watch:

Maverick Handley (49), Billy Cook (40), Garrett Stallings (70), Kyle Brnovich, Carter Baumler (22)

-

This year is unique in that there are 4 guys that I would be stunned if they didn't make it and then a bunch of long shots. There aren't any bubble cases for me right now. Maybe someone will play themselves up or down into the bubble as the season goes on.

I expect Mayo to be added during the season and Norby to be traded. McDermott is pretty likely to pitch out of the bullpen at some point, too.

Ambruester could be a up/down guy for us this year in the pen and find himself on the 40 man.

Handley could be added if we have any injury at catcher and could also be added because McCann is a FA. Catching depth is just too thin in MLB to develop Handley all this way and not take advantage of his three optionable years.
